Director, Engineering - Compute
The Compute group is responsible for the high scale multi-cloud container based compute environment supporting all of Datadog. As the engineering leader responsible for this area, your domain is broad, including cloud provider account and relationship management, Linux systems engineering, distributed systems software engineering, and systems engineering focused on scalability, reliability, and security. Your group offers a Kubernetes based PaaS, along with tools and systems to enable users working in a large multi-cluster environment.
It is your responsibility to ensure that this platform enables the engineering community at Datadog to work efficiently and safely.
